/*
|
|
* monitor.c
|
|
*
|
|
* Created: Mar 2021
|
|
* Author: Arjan te Marvelde
|
|
*
|
|
* Command shell on stdin/stdout.
|
|
* Collects characters and parses commandstring.
|
|
* Additional commands can easily be added.
|
|
*/

/*
|
|
* Command line parser
|
|
*/
|
|
void mon_parse(char* s)
|
|
{
|
|
char *p;
|
|
int i;
|
|
|
|
p = s; // Set to start of string
|
|
nargs = 0;
|
|
while (*p!='\0') // Assume stringlength >0
|
|
{
|
|
while (*p==' ') p++; // Skip whitespace
|
|
if (*p=='\0') break; // String might end in spaces
|
|
argv[nargs++] = p; // Store first valid char loc after whitespace
|
|
while ((*p!=' ')&&(*p!='\0')) p++; // Skip non-whitespace
|
|
}
|
|
if (nargs==0) return; // No command or parameter
|
|
for (i=0; i<NCMD; i++) // Lookup shell command
|
|
if (strncmp(argv[0], shell[i].cmdstr, shell[i].cmdlen) == 0) break;
|
|
if (i<NCMD)
|
|
(*shell[i].cmd)();
|
|
else // Unknown command
|
|
{
|
|
for (i=0; i<NCMD; i++) // Print help if no match
|
|
printf("%s\n %s\n", shell[i].cmdsyn, shell[i].help);
|
|
}
|
|
}
|
|
|
|
/*
|
|
* Monitor process
|
|
* This function collects characters from stdin until CR
|
|
* Then the command is send to a parser and executed.
|
|
*/
|
|
void mon_evaluate(void)
|
|
{
|
|
static int i = 0;
|
|
int c = getchar_timeout_us(10L); // NOTE: this is the only SDK way to read from stdin
|
|
if (c==PICO_ERROR_TIMEOUT) return; // Early bail out
|
|
|
|
switch (c)
|
|
{
|
|
case CR: // CR : need to parse command string
|
|
putchar('\n'); // Echo character, assume terminal appends CR
|
|
mon_cmd[i] = '\0'; // Terminate command string
|
|
if (i>0) // something to parse?
|
|
mon_parse(mon_cmd); // --> process command
|
|
i=0; // reset index
|
|
printf("Pico> "); // prompt
|
|
break;
|
|
case LF:
|
|
break; // Ignore, assume CR as terminator
|
|
default:
|
|
if ((c<32)||(c>=128)) break; // Only allow alfanumeric
|
|
putchar((char)c); // Echo character
|
|
mon_cmd[i] = (char)c; // store in command string
|
|
if (i<CMD_LEN) i++; // check range and increment
|
|
break;
|
|
}
|
|
}
